Social networking has been sweeping the internet landscape for years and if your law firm is not taking advantages social networking has to offer, you may just get left in the dust.
If you aren’t familiar with social networking, I’m referring to sites like facebook and twitter. These sites give you a platform to interact with your current and potential clients and inform them what you are all about. They also help you network with others in your field and learn from the people you interact with.
